Merlin Awarded $1,250 Grant from PLATO for “Building Community through Laughter” Project

GRANT AWARD for public philosophy “BUILDING COMMUNITY THROUGH LAUGHTER” project An interactive public philosophy program with philosopher and comedian, Rodney Norman, that explores the relationship between comedy, community, and the good life. Merlin Awarded $2,000 Grant Award from PLATO for “Art as Transformation” Project

GRANT AWARD for public philosophy “art as transformation” project An innovative public philosophy program exploring the role of art in society & our everyday lives.
